ATP – Hamburg> Tsitsipas, the earth as a remedy

Two weeks after his elimination from entry to Wimbledon, Stefanos Tsitsipas regained his colors on German clay in Hamburg, an ATP 500 classified tournament. The Greek, who has the opportunity to overtake Rafael Nadal in the standings in the event of a final victory, won against the local and tough Dominik Koepfer, 59e world player: 7–6 (2), 6–3 in 1h45 of play.

Very solid on his faceoff, as he is now used to (30 points won out of 35 behind his first ball, 13 out of 26 for the second), the number one seed has never panicked despite the many break opportunities (3 out of 14). A perfectly mastered start for Stefanos who will be opposed to Serbian Filip Krajinovic for a place in the last four.
